Demographics details for Huntley, IL vs Gallitzin, PA
Population Overview
Compare main population characteristics in Huntley, IL vs Gallitzin, PA.
Data | Huntley | Gallitzin |
---|---|---|
Population | 28,138 | 1,508 |
Median Age | 49.1 years | 39.4 years |
Median Income | $83,357 | $52,500 |
Married Families | 45.0% | 32.0% |
Poverty Level | 4% | 12% |
Unemployment Rate | 6.0 | 5.2 |
Population Comparison: Huntley vs Gallitzin
- In Huntley, the population is higher at 28,138, compared to 1,508 in Gallitzin.
- Residents in Huntley have a higher median age of 49.1 years compared to 39.4 years in Gallitzin.
- Huntley has a higher median income of $83,357 compared to $52,500 in Gallitzin.
- A higher percentage of married families is found in Huntley at 45.0% compared to 32.0% in Gallitzin.
- The poverty level is higher in Gallitzin at 12%, compared to 4% in Huntley.
- The unemployment rate in Huntley is higher at 6.0%, compared to 5.2% in Gallitzin.

Health Statistics
The health statistics provide insights into prevalent health conditions in two communities.
Health Metric | Huntley | Gallitzin |
---|---|---|
Mental Health Not Good | 13.7% | 18.3% |
Physical Health Not Good | 8.8% | 12.1% |
Depression | 19.2% | 25.2% |
Smoking | 12.1% | 20.9% |
Binge Drinking | 18.7% | 18.5% |
Obesity | 29.4% | 38.6% |
Disability Percentage | 13.0% | 22.0% |
Health Statistics Comparison: Huntley vs Gallitzin
- In Gallitzin, a higher percentage report poor mental health at 18.3% compared to 13.7% in Huntley.
- Higher depression rates are seen in Gallitzin at 25.2% versus 19.2% in Huntley.
- Gallitzin has a higher smoking rate at 20.9% compared to 12.1% in Huntley.
- Binge drinking is more common in Huntley at 18.7% compared to 18.5% in Gallitzin.
- Gallitzin has higher obesity rates at 38.6% compared to 29.4% in Huntley.
- There is a higher percentage of disabled individuals in Gallitzin at 22.0% compared to 13.0% in Huntley.
Education Levels
The educational attainment in the area helps gauge the workforce's skill level and economic potential.
Education Level | Huntley | Gallitzin |
---|---|---|
No Schooling | 0.4% (116) | 1.1% (16) |
High School Diploma | 16.1% (4,517) | 29.8% (449) |
Less than High School | 6.0% (1,686) | 20.6% (310) |
Bachelor's Degree and Higher | 28.4% (8,004) | 9.9% (150) |
Education Levels Comparison: Huntley vs Gallitzin
- In Gallitzin, a larger percentage of residents lack formal schooling at 1.1% compared to 0.4% in Huntley.
- In Gallitzin, the rate of residents with high school diplomas is higher at 29.8% compared to 16.1% in Huntley.
- The percentage of residents with less than a high school education is higher in Gallitzin at 20.6%, compared to 6.0% in Huntley.
- A higher percentage of residents in Huntley hold a bachelor's degree or higher at 28.4% compared to 9.9% in Gallitzin.
